Requirements

  • 10+ years of software engineering experience building large-scale distributed systems
  • Have designed and implemented complex software systems
  • Broad knowledge of AWS, server programming, databases, and cloud architectures
  • Experience working with container frameworks (Docker) and container orchestration tools (AWS ECS, Kubernetes)
  • Experience with Microservices, API architecture and management
  • Work experience in a global and distributed environment
  • Ability to demonstrate clear communications about your architectural designs, decisions and rationale for your design direction
  • Technology stack: Java/Spring, AWS/Containers, Go, R, and Python

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gain an understanding of the current system’s architecture and functionality
  • Develop a strategic direction for the licensing platform and ensure that the tactical direction is to support the larger strategy
  • Drive broad consensus and agreement across teams and GEOs
  • Lead the design and implementation of scalable, maintainable software solutions
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to a geographically distributed development team, fostering collaboration and knowledge sharing
  • Ensure the security, performance, and reliability of the platform
  • Stay informed about emerging technologies and industry trends, incorporating them into the platform’s architecture by conducting code and architecture reviews
  • Raise the bar within the team and across the organization
  • Partner with Product Management and Business leads regarding future platform and technology issues and the effect of decisions on all projects
  • Create formal networks with industry and cross organizational leadership communities to develop standards, and foster platform growth
  • Work on issues where analysis of situations or data requires and evaluation of intangibles
